Testing Email Viability at the Source
Let’s break down what happens behind the scenes: when you verify an email in real time, the system performs a lightweight SMTP handshake with the receiving mail server. It checks if the domain has a valid MX record, if the server accepts mail for that address, and whether the mailbox is actually open. This isn’t guessing—it’s confirmation based on real communication protocols. The result? You avoid adding addresses that bounce, which directly improves your data integrity and sender reputation.
Risky Addresses That Don’t Belong in Your CRM
Not all emails are created equal. Some domains accept mail for any address—these are catch-all accounts. While technically valid, they’re a red flag. Many of these belong to role addresses like info@, support@, or admin@, or are used by automated systems. You’re not just wasting a send—you’re risking misdirected messages or a false sense of engagement.
Disposable email domains—like tempmail.com or throwaway-mail.net—are another common risk. These are often used for sign-ups that never intend to stay. If a patient’s address is a disposable domain, your follow-up message won’t land in a real inbox. Worse, it might get flagged as spam by email providers, hurting your domain’s reputation.
That’s where filtering matters. A solid email validation service identifies and flags these high-risk cases—catch-all domains, role addresses, disposable domains—so you know exactly what to exclude. It’s not about blocking all role emails, but about avoiding those that don’t represent real individuals who can engage with care communications.
For healthcare teams, this means cleaner lists, fewer bounces, and stronger data hygiene. The goal isn’t perfection—it’s making sure every email you send is going to a real person who can receive it. Understanding Email Verification Verdicts in Healthcare Contexts
You don’t want a reminder about a follow-up appointment sent to an invalid address or a shared inbox that never gets opened. In healthcare CRM systems, every email matters—especially when it’s tied to patient records.
What Each Verdict Means
When you verify emails at scale, you’re not just cleaning data—you’re ensuring compliance, reducing risk, and improving patient engagement. Here’s what the most common verification results mean in practice.
| Verdict | Meaning | Implication for Healthcare CRM |
|---|---|---|
| Valid | Confirmed deliverable address. The server accepts mail for this mailbox. | Safe to use for appointment reminders, wellness updates, and secure messaging. These are your primary contact points. |
| Invalid | Server explicitly rejects the address (e.g., “user unknown”). | Remove immediately. Sending to invalid addresses increases bounce rates, hurts sender reputation, and may trigger spam filters. |
| Catch-all | Server accepts all email addresses, even non-existent ones. | Highly risky. Often indicates a role account, shared inbox, or automated system. Do not send sensitive communications here. |
| Risky | Address is technically valid but shows signs of poor deliverability—domain history issues, temporary block, or low reputation. | Use only for non-critical messages. Monitor closely; these often end up in spam folders or get rejected silently. |
| Disposable | Short-lived email from services like Mailinator or TempMail. | Not suitable for long-term patient communication. These addresses expire quickly and are often used for spam or account sign-ups. |
Understanding these verdicts helps you treat each address appropriately. You can’t treat a catch-all the same way you treat a verified patient email.

The Role of Inbox Placement Testing in Healthcare Messaging
Even if an email address passes basic validation, it doesn’t mean the message will land in the inbox—especially for healthcare providers sending time-sensitive updates. Email providers like Gmail, Outlook, and Apple Mail use complex filtering rules that can quarantine messages deemed suspicious, even if they come from a valid domain. For appointment reminders, medication alerts, or care coordination updates, this isn’t just inconvenient—it’s a risk.
Why Deliverability Isn’t Guaranteed With Validity
A valid email address doesn’t guarantee inbox placement. Factors like sender reputation, content tone, frequency, and authentication setup (SPF, DKIM, DMARC) all influence whether your message gets delivered or sidelined. The HIPAA environment adds another layer—many healthcare senders are flagged by filters due to the sensitivity of their content, even when sending compliant messages. A single missed care reminder can lead to patient non-attendance, increased administrative burden, or worse. This is where inbox placement testing becomes essential. What’s the difference between a catch-all and a role account?
A catch-all accepts all emails sent to a domain, often used in misconfigured servers. Role accounts are specific addresses like care@ or support@ that serve a function but are not tied to an individual.
